Jin Nong (1687 – 1764): The Eccentric Poet Painter

Jin Nong, born in Hangzhou in 1687, stands as a singular figure in Chinese art history—a celebrated painter and calligrapher who defied convention and embraced an unconventional path to artistic success. Unlike many artists of his era striving for patronage and acclaim within the imperial court, Jin Nong cultivated a distinctive style rooted in amateur scholarship and fueled by a desire for independence. His legacy resides not merely in his exquisite paintings but also in his pioneering exploration of self-portraiture and his embrace of collaborative techniques that blurred the lines between art and commerce.
  • Early Life & Influences: Jin Nong’s upbringing fostered an appreciation for traditional Chinese culture, particularly Confucian ethics and Daoist philosophy. These influences profoundly shaped his artistic sensibilities, informing his meticulous attention to detail and his symbolic use of imagery—a hallmark of the Shu Fa style.
  • Yangzhou Residence & Artistic Practice: Moving to Yangzhou in his sixties, Jin Nong established a workshop where he produced ink stones and lanterns alongside his disciples. This entrepreneurial spirit allowed him to sustain himself financially while pursuing his artistic passions, prioritizing painting over formal bureaucratic roles.
  • The Mei Blossom Motif: Jin Nong’s fame stemmed largely from his depictions of mei blossoms—fragile flowers symbolizing resilience and renewal—which became immensely popular in Yangzhou during his lifetime. These paintings exemplify the Shu Fa style's emphasis on capturing fleeting beauty and conveying profound philosophical ideas.
  • Technique & Collaboration: Jin Nong famously employed ghost painters, assistants who executed brushstrokes under his direction, maximizing productivity and ensuring artistic consistency. Luo Ping served as his editor and collaborator, meticulously documenting Jin Nong’s oeuvre—a testament to the artist's commitment to preserving his vision.
  • Legacy & Historical Significance: Jin Nong is recognized as one of the Eight Eccentrics of Yangzhou, a group of artists who challenged societal norms and pursued artistic endeavors with unwavering dedication. His self-portraits represent an unprecedented innovation in Chinese art, marking a pivotal moment in exploring psychological depth within visual representation. He remains an enduring symbol of artistic integrity and intellectual curiosity—a figure whose work continues to inspire admiration for its beauty and philosophical resonance.

Notable Paintings & Artistic Style

Jin Nong’s paintings are characterized by their meticulous execution, masterful use of color palettes (primarily monochrome), and profound symbolic depth. He adhered strictly to the Shu Fa style—a method emphasizing simplicity and capturing the essence of nature—resulting in landscapes imbued with serene tranquility and portraits conveying introspective contemplation. Recurring motifs included mei blossoms, bamboo, chrysanthemums, and plum trees – each carrying specific connotations related to Confucian virtues like integrity, righteousness, benevolence, and wisdom. His compositions often incorporated elements of Buddhist iconography, reflecting his spiritual beliefs and contributing to the broader artistic landscape of Qing Dynasty China.
  • FOUR POEMS: This scroll exemplifies Jin Nong’s signature style—a monochromatic depiction of mei blossoms conveying profound philosophical ideas.
  • Ink Play: Demonstrates Jin Nong's skill in capturing fleeting beauty and reflecting Daoist principles.

Influence & Artistic Innovation

Jin Nong’s pioneering exploration of self-portraiture stands apart from the artistic conventions of his time, establishing a precedent for psychological realism within Chinese painting. His collaborative approach—utilizing ghost painters and employing Luo Ping as editor—challenged established practices and underscored the importance of artistic integrity. Furthermore, Jin Nong's unwavering devotion to Shu Fa style solidified its position as one of China’s most influential artistic traditions, inspiring subsequent generations of artists to prioritize simplicity, contemplation, and symbolic representation. His work continues to resonate with scholars and art enthusiasts alike, cementing his place as a visionary artist who reshaped the boundaries of Chinese visual culture.
